On Saturday evening, a major fire caused a cloud of smoke visible in the sky of the Parisian agglomeration. The fire was declared shortly after 21 hours in a pastry factory in the industrial area of Roissy-en-France, near the airport Roissy Charles-de-Gaulle. The building was ravaged by the flames but no wounded were to be deplored.
The fire, which broke out on Saturday evening, did not disrupt airport traffic.
